    Geisha (芸者) ( / ˈɡeɪʃə /; Japanese: [ɡeːɕa] ), [1] [2] also known as geiko (芸子) (in Kyoto and Kanazawa) or geigi (芸妓), are female Japanese performing artists and entertainers trained in traditional Japanese performing arts styles, such as dance, music and singing, as well as being proficient conversationalists and hosts.

  9. Sep 11, 2021 · To explain what a geisha is, let’s look at the word itself. The word ‘geisha,’ written 芸者, combines two kanji. ‘Gei (芸)’ can mean ‘entertainment’ or some art or skill. ‘Sha (者)’ generally means person. In other words, they are elite female artists who specialize in traditional Japanese arts.
